Lemon Sky Studios

Lemon Sky Studios is a CGI studio that produces art for animation and video game titles, based in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ia.

Notable video game titles that the studio has been involved with include Final Fantasy VII Remake, Resident Evil Resistance, Warcraft III: Reforged, StarCraft: Remastered, Uncharted: The Lost Legacy, Marvel's Spider-Man, and Gears of War 5.[1]

The studio has also done work for notable animation series' such as TruckTown[2] and Nickelodeon's Middle School Moguls.[3]

History

In 2010, Lemon Sky Studios was officially founded by Malaysian artists Cheng-Fei Wong and Ken Foong.[4]

In 2014, Lemon Sky signed a memorandum of understanding with Bandai Namco Singapore to facilitate partnerships on the co-development of future games.[5]

In 2015, Lemon Sky opened a new office branch in Penang, Malaysia, which currently houses a team of over 30 artists.

In 2017, Lemon Sky celebrated its anniversary by hosting an event called "Hello Lemon Sky" where members of the public were invited to the studio in a celebration of all of the studio's work in the art and animation industry thus far.[6]

In 2018, Lemon Sky debuted its first original animation title: AstroLOLogy[7] - a series of comedic animated shorts featuring a cast of 12 characters who each represent stylized versions of the western zodiac star signs.[8] As of April 2020, AstroLOLogy has reached over 566,000 subscribers on its official YouTube channel.[9] AstroLOLogy has since gone on to win numerous awards from various international media and film festivals.[10][11][12]

In 2019, Lemon Sky won the Exporter of the Year award at the Malaysian Export Excellence Awards 2019.[13]

Organization

Lemon Sky's production team is made up of over 300 artists and production staff with a wide range of nationalities and expertise.[14]

The studio's headquarters is located in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, with an additional branch located in the city of Penang.

The studio's founders, Cheng-Fei Wong and Ken Foong, currently act as the Chief Executive Officer and Chief Creative Officer of the studio respectively.
